Metal cladding repair services involve assessing and restoring the protective outer layer of a building’s exterior made from metal panels. Over time, exposure to the elements can cause issues such as corrosion, dents, warping, or loose panels. Skilled contractors examine the existing cladding to identify areas that need attention and then carry out repairs to restore the material’s integrity and appearance. This process helps prevent further damage, ensuring the building remains protected from moisture, wind, and other environmental factors.

Many common problems that metal cladding repair services address include rust and corrosion, which can weaken the panels and lead to leaks if left untreated. Dents and physical damage from impacts or severe weather can compromise the cladding’s barrier function. Additionally, panels may become loose or misaligned, increasing the risk of water infiltration and reducing the overall stability of the exterior. Repairing these issues promptly can extend the lifespan of the cladding and maintain the building’s structural safety.

The overview below groups typical Metal Cladding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Coventry, CT.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or metal cladding repairs in Coventry range from $250-$600, covering patching, sealing, or small panel replacements.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of damage and material type.

Medium Projects - Larger repairs, such as replacing several panels or addressing moderate corrosion, generally cost between $600-$2,000. These projects are common for commercial or residential buildings needing more extensive work.

Major Renovations - Extensive repairs involving significant panel replacement or structural reinforcement can range from $2,000-$5,000, with some complex cases reaching higher. Fewer projects push into this higher tier, often requiring specialized services.

Full Cladding Replacement - Complete removal and installation of new metal cladding typically start around $5,000 and can exceed $15,000 for large or intricate buildings. Local contractors usually handle these large-scale projects, which are less frequent but necessary for substantial upgrades.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of metal cladding can be repaired? Local contractors typically repair a variety of metal cladding materials, including aluminum, steel, and zinc, depending on the specific needs of the building.

How can I tell if my metal cladding needs repair? Signs such as rust, corrosion, dents, or loose panels may indicate that repair services are needed for metal cladding.

What are common causes of metal cladding damage? Damage can result from weather exposure, physical impacts, or age-related wear, which may require professional repair to restore integrity.

Are there different repair methods for various types of metal cladding? Yes, repair techniques can vary based on the material and extent of damage, with local service providers able to recommend appropriate solutions.
